Summit LifeWhat are some of the unique challenges for blended families? With the number of marriages that are blended nearing 50% of all marriages, it's vital that churches begin to understand how to best support and minister to moms, dads, and children in blended families. Scott and Vanessa Martindale have a heart for helping couples navigate the process of blending a family in a healthy way. They join Ken and Deb to share their own story and talk about the resources available to equip and educate blended families and help them flourish as Kingdom families.
Scott Martindale is a Licensed Professional Counselor for more than 15 years and has helped couples, marriages, and families on their journey through life’s challenges. Vanessa Martindale is a registered nurse and is pursuing a master’s degree in Marriage and Family Therapy at The King’s University. They have been married for over 8 years and together founded Blended Kingdom Families—a ministry that is committed to breaking the generational cycle of divorce, equipping marriages, and educating blended families with resources and practical skills through the truth of God’s word. Scott and Vanessa are a blended family with four sons and four golden retrievers and live in the Dallas-Fort Worth Metroplex.
